Designing Professional Delivery Service Business Cards

delivery service business cards 2

When designing your delivery service business cards, it’s essential to prioritize professionalism and effective communication. Here are some key guidelines to keep in mind:

1. Keep it Simple and Clean

Ensure your business card is clutter-free and easy to read. Use a clean design with legible fonts and avoid overcrowding the card with excessive information. Use your company logo prominently and align all elements in a visually appealing manner.

2. Include Key Information

Include essential contact information, such as your business name, address, phone number, and email address. Consider adding website and social media handles if applicable. Keep in mind that space is limited, so be concise and prioritize the most relevant details.

3. Highlight Your Unique Selling Points

Consider including a brief tagline or a few bullet points that highlight the unique aspects of your delivery service. This could be your fast delivery times, exceptional customer service, or competitive pricing. Make it clear why potential customers should choose your business over others.

4. Use High-Quality Materials

Investing in high-quality business card materials will reflect positively on your brand image. Opt for sturdy card stock and consider finishes such as matte or glossy. Quality business cards make a lasting impression, whereas flimsy or poorly printed ones may be quickly discarded.

5. Don’t Forget Branding

Ensure your business cards align with your overall brand identity. Use consistent colors, fonts, and imagery that accurately represent your delivery service business. This will help create a cohesive and recognizable brand image.

Distributing Your Delivery Service Business Cards Effectively

Once you have designed your professional business cards, it’s time to distribute them strategically. Here are some effective methods to consider:

1. Carry Them Everywhere

Always keep a stack of your business cards on hand, whether you’re attending industry events, networking functions, or even in everyday situations. You never know when you might encounter a potential customer or business opportunity. Be proactive in offering your business card whenever relevant.

2. Collaborate with Local Businesses

Build mutually beneficial partnerships with local businesses that complement your delivery service. For example, consider offering business card displays at local restaurants, cafes, or retail stores. This can help increase your visibility within the community and attract potential customers.

3. Utilize Direct Mail Campaigns

Consider including your business card in direct mail campaigns targeting your desired customer base. Combining your delivery service offerings with targeted mailings can help attract new customers who may not be actively searching for delivery services but would benefit from your offerings.

4. Attend Trade Shows and Expos

Participating in trade shows and expos relevant to your industry can provide an excellent opportunity to distribute your business cards and generate leads. Ensure you have a well-designed booth or table where attendees can easily pick up your card and learn more about your delivery service business.
